| |
VB.NET - Ein- und UmsteigerRe: RichTextBox, zusätzliche Eigenschaften | | | Autor: spatzimatzi | Datum: 23.11.16 11:20 |
| Hallo Manfred x, hallo Franki,
#Manfred x
Vielen dank für den Link. Habe mir die Seite angeschaut, kann aber nicht erkennen, wie ich diese einbauen und wie ich es nützen könnte.
Glaube weiterhin, dass, sofern ich die Position im Rtf-Text kenne, eine Veränderung der Formatierungsregeln relativ einfach zu handhaben ist. Zumal es sich um Formatierungen um eine Absatzformatierung handelt.
Was ich brauche:
- Gegenstück zu SelectionStart, nämlich bezogen auf den Rtf-Text
- In welchen Absatz befinde ich mich, bezogen auf den Rtf-Text. Die Anzahl würde genügen. Daraus könnte ich die Position ermitteln.
- In welchem Satz befinde ich mich, bezogen auf den Rtf-Text.
Werde auch versuchen, über SelectionStart bestimmte Textpassagen aus dem Absatz für die Suche im Rtf-Text zu bilden. Werden die Strings gefunden, dann bin ich hoffentlich im richtigen Absatz.
Wenn jemand bessere Möglichkeiten hat, nur her damit. Ich würde mich riesig freuen.
#Franki
Ich möchte keine Textverarbeitung schreiben. Es sollte nur WordPad nachgebildet werden. Und ein Rad neu erfinden möchte ich schon gar nicht!
Folgende Situation liegt vor.
In einer Anwendung habe ich mehrere Rtb-Controls. Da diese formatierten Text aufnehmen sollen, aber relativ klein in den Abmessungen sind, kann der Anwender über Doppelklick ein Editorfenster aufrufen mit dem Inhalt aus dem Rtb-Control.
Dieser Form habe ich dann noch ein Menü und eine Buttonleiste verpasst. Damit kann der Anwender einfach und komfortabel arbeiten. Wird das Fenster geschlossen und es liegen Änderungen vor, dann werden diese zurückgeschrieben.
Wenn es jedoch Editoren oder Textverarbeitungen gibt, die ich aufrufen und den Rtf-Text übergeben könnte, wäre dies natürlich sehr schön. Beim Schließen des Programmes müßte der Rtf-Text dann zurückgegeben werden, ohne irgendwelche Handlungen auszuführen.
Leider kenne ich kein Programm. Vielleicht kannst du mir Informationen geben!
Vielen Dank für die Informationen
spatzimatzi | |
RichTextBox, zusätzliche Eigenschaften | 2.548 | spatzimatzi | 22.11.16 12:29 | Re: RichTextBox, zusätzliche Eigenschaften | 1.835 | effeff | 22.11.16 16:14 | Re: RichTextBox, zusätzliche Eigenschaften | 1.763 | spatzimatzi | 22.11.16 16:32 | RichTextBox -Class Library | 1.838 | Manfred X | 22.11.16 22:30 | Re: RichTextBox, zusätzliche Eigenschaften | 1.748 | Franki | 23.11.16 01:59 | Re: RichTextBox, zusätzliche Eigenschaften | 1.775 | spatzimatzi | 23.11.16 11:20 | Re: RichTextBox, zusätzliche Eigenschaften | 1.738 | Manfred X | 24.11.16 06:07 | Re: RichTextBox, zusätzliche Eigenschaften | 1.696 | spatzimatzi | 24.11.16 14:13 | Re: RichTextBox, zusätzliche Eigenschaften | 1.802 | Manfred X | 25.11.16 06:58 | Re: RichTextBox, zusätzliche Eigenschaften | 1.685 | spatzimatzi | 08.12.16 16:43 | Re: RichTextBox, zusätzliche Eigenschaften | 1.835 | GPM | 08.12.16 17:20 |
| Sie sind nicht angemeldet! Um auf diesen Beitrag zu antworten oder neue Beiträge schreiben zu können, müssen Sie sich zunächst anmelden.
Einloggen | Neu registrieren |
|
|
sevISDN 1.0
Überwachung aller eingehender Anrufe!
Die DLL erkennt alle über die CAPI-Schnittstelle eingehenden Anrufe und teilt Ihnen sogar mit, aus welchem Ortsbereich der Anruf stammt. Weitere Highlights: Online-Rufident, Erkennung der Anrufbehandlung u.v.m. Weitere InfosTipp des Monats Neu! sevEingabe 3.0
Einfach stark!
Ein einziges Eingabe-Control für alle benötigten Eingabetypen und -formate, inkl. Kalender-, Taschenrechner und Floskelfunktion, mehrspaltige ComboBox mit DB-Anbindung, ImageComboBox u.v.m. Weitere Infos
|
|
|
Copyright ©2000-2024 vb@rchiv Dieter Otter Alle Rechte vorbehalten.
Microsoft, Windows und Visual Basic sind entweder eingetragene Marken oder Marken der Microsoft Corporation in den USA und/oder anderen Ländern. Weitere auf dieser Homepage aufgeführten Produkt- und Firmennamen können geschützte Marken ihrer jeweiligen Inhaber sein.
Diese Seiten wurden optimiert für eine Bildschirmauflösung von mind. 1280x1024 Pixel
|
|